Iman Vellani was born on September 3, 2002, in Karachi, Pakistan, and moved to Canada with her family when she was around a year old, providing her with a unique cultural perspective.

She is of Pakistani descent and has expressed a deep connection to her heritage, often mentioning how it influences her work and personal life.

Vellani made her acting debut in the Marvel Cinematic Universe (MCU) as Kamala Khan, also known as Ms.

Marvel, which is significant as Kamala is the first Muslim superhero to headline her own Marvel series.

Before landing her role in the MCU, Iman was an avid comic book reader, particularly of Marvel comics, which helped her embody the character of Kamala Khan authentically.

Vellani is a self-proclaimed nerd and has shared her love for video games, anime, and pop culture, which resonates with her character's identity as a superhero enthusiast.

She has a background in theater, having participated in school productions, which honed her acting skills before she was cast in a major role.

Iman was selected for the role of Ms.

Marvel after an extensive casting process that included thousands of applicants, showcasing her talent and unique fit for the character.

She has stated that her family was initially skeptical about her pursuing acting, but they eventually supported her after she secured the role in the MCU.

Vellani has a keen interest in cinema and has mentioned her admiration for filmmakers like Edgar Wright and Taika Waititi, indicating her passion for storytelling beyond just acting.

Iman is also known for her advocacy for representation in media, emphasizing the importance of diverse stories being told in Hollywood.

Despite her rapid rise to fame, she maintains a private personal life and is known to be grounded and humble, often expressing gratitude for her opportunities.

Vellani has noted that she drew inspiration from her own experiences as a South Asian Canadian when portraying Kamala Khan, making her performance relatable to many fans.

She has a fascination with the science of storytelling, understanding how narratives shape perceptions and emotions, which she applies in her acting.

Vellani is a strong proponent of the importance of education and has mentioned that she values learning, whether it be in her acting career or personal life.

Iman Vellani is also a skilled artist, having created her own comic book art, further connecting her to the world of comics and her character.

She advocates for mental health awareness, sharing her own experiences and encouraging conversations around the topic, particularly in the entertainment industry.
